Retinoids, which are readily available by prescription( such as Retin-A)and non-prescription (Differin)are a reputable technique for clearing the skin of blackheads. "Retinoids work by promoting skin turn over and also lowering the 'dampness'of the skin cells to avoid obstruction of the follicular ostia,"Suozzi describes. "Nonetheless, with ongoing therapy, the plugged ostia begin to boost, and also with skin turnover advertised , they are less most likely to end up being obstructed in the future,"she says. Not only will a retinoid aid boost acne, but it's terrific for anti-aging and skin regrowth. A research study published in March 2016 in the Journal of Cosmetic Dermatology discovered that in only 4 weeks of using a retinol(a lower-concentration retinoid ), topics experienced a boost in collagen production and epidermal density, as well as in 12 weeks" significant decrease in face creases." It can be tempting to jettison away all your dead skin in immediate satisfaction using the aid of an exfoliating scrub. While chemical exfoliators (like AHAs )can be valuable, Saedi suggests staying clear of over-exfoliating with a granule scrub as you may have been educated to do as a teen, when you manually scrubbed granules right into your skin until it was red. Dermatologists as a whole recommend scrubing up to three times each week, relying on the item you are using as well as your skin type. Suozzi advises battling need to stand out any kind of acnes." If you press your blackheads, you can trigger the hair follicle to fracture and also induce the development


of an inflammatory lesion, or cyst,"she says.

Updated: 04/12/2021 RECAP: Blackheads or "open comedones" are obstructed pores that might resemble tiny specks of dirt. In truth, they manifest when the mix of excess oil and also dead skin cell build-up within a blocked pore comes in touching air. This triggers the accumulation to oxidize or darken.


To deal with blackheads: Search for skin treatment products created with active ingredients such as salicylic acid and adapalene (topical retinoid) Do not try a do it yourself blackhead removal that can transform a small blackhead problem into a significant outbreak!
